AI & Automation Google Drive Airtable Expense Tracking n8n

AI-Powered Receipt Data Extraction & Tracking

Automatically extract merchant, date, amount, and details from receipts in Google Drive and log them to Airtable for instant expense tracking.

Download Template JSON · n8n compatible · Free
Visual diagram of an AI receipt data extraction workflow connecting Google Drive, VLM Run AI, and Airtable

What This Workflow Does

Manual receipt processing is a tedious, error-prone task that drains hours from your team each week. This automation solves that by creating a seamless, intelligent pipeline from receipt capture to structured data.

The workflow monitors a designated Google Drive folder for new receipt uploads—whether they're photos from a phone, scanned PDFs, or emailed attachments saved to Drive. When a new file appears, it's automatically processed by the VLM Run AI node, which extracts key details like merchant name, transaction date, total amount, currency, and often line items or tax amounts. This structured data is then instantly written to an Airtable base, creating a searchable, filterable expense log.

Beyond simple extraction, this system eliminates manual data entry, reduces human error, and accelerates expense reporting cycles from days to minutes. It's particularly valuable for freelancers, small businesses, and finance teams managing multiple employee expenses.

How It Works

The automation follows a logical, event-driven sequence that mimics how a human would process receipts—but at machine speed and accuracy.

1. Trigger: New File Detection

The workflow starts with a Google Drive trigger node that watches a specific folder (like "Receipts to Process") for new files. It can be configured to check at regular intervals or in real-time using webhooks if available.

2. File Preparation & AI Processing

When a new image or PDF is detected, the workflow downloads the file and prepares it for analysis. The VLM Run node then analyzes the receipt using vision-language models trained on document understanding. It identifies and extracts structured data fields regardless of receipt format or layout.

3. Data Validation & Transformation

Extracted data passes through a Set node that formats and validates information—ensuring dates are in correct format, amounts are numerical, and required fields are present. This step can include basic business logic, like flagging unusually high expenses for review.

4. Database Logging

The clean, structured data is then written to Airtable, creating a new record in your expense tracking base. Each record includes the extracted fields plus metadata like the original file link and processing timestamp for full auditability.

5. Optional Notifications & Follow-ups

The workflow can be extended to send confirmation emails or Slack messages, trigger approval requests, or even categorize expenses automatically based on merchant or amount rules.

Who This Is For

This automation delivers immediate value to several key audiences. Freelancers and solopreneurs can eliminate receipt clutter and streamline tax preparation. Small business owners and finance teams can process employee expenses faster with consistent data formatting. Accountants and bookkeepers can reduce manual data entry time by 80% or more, focusing instead on analysis and advisory work.

It's also ideal for project-based businesses that need to track expenses against specific clients or jobs, and startups wanting to implement professional expense tracking without expensive software subscriptions. Even larger organizations can use this as a departmental solution before enterprise system rollout.

Pro tip: Create a shared Google Drive folder for your team's receipts and set this workflow as the central processing hub. This creates a standardized expense submission process without requiring everyone to learn new software.

What You'll Need

  1. A Google Drive account with a dedicated folder for receipt uploads.
  2. An Airtable account with a base containing fields for: Merchant, Date, Amount, Currency, Category, and optionally File URL.
  3. VLM Run API credentials (sign up at app.vlm.run to get your API key).
  4. An n8n instance—either self-hosted or using n8n.cloud.
  5. The VLM Run node installed in your n8n instance via the "Install" feature in the node panel.

Quick Setup Guide

Follow these steps to implement this automation in under 30 minutes:

  1. Import the template into your n8n workspace using the downloaded JSON file.
  2. Configure Google Drive connection by authenticating with OAuth2 and specifying your receipt folder ID.
  3. Add your VLM Run API key in the VLM Run node settings (sign up at app.vlm.run if you haven't).
  4. Set up your Airtable base with the required fields and connect it to the Airtable node.
  5. Test with a sample receipt by uploading one to your Google Drive folder and verifying the data appears correctly in Airtable.
  6. Activate the workflow and set it to run on a schedule (e.g., every 15 minutes) or trigger via webhook for real-time processing.

Key Benefits

Save 5+ hours monthly per employee on manual receipt entry and categorization. What used to be a weekly chore becomes a background process that happens automatically.

Eliminate data entry errors from misread amounts or mistyped merchant names. AI extraction consistently reads information correctly, improving financial accuracy.

Accelerate reimbursement cycles from days to hours. Employees get paid faster, improving satisfaction and reducing administrative follow-up.

Create searchable expense records instantly. Find any transaction by merchant, date, or amount in seconds instead of digging through folders or emails.

Build a scalable foundation for more advanced automations like budget alerts, expense reporting, or integration with accounting software like QuickBooks or Xero.

Frequently Asked Questions

Common questions about AI receipt extraction and expense automation

AI-powered receipt data extraction uses machine learning to automatically read and interpret information from scanned receipts or photos. It captures key details like merchant name, date, total amount, and tax without manual typing.

For businesses, this eliminates hours of data entry, reduces human error, and speeds up expense reporting and reimbursement cycles. It turns a pile of paper receipts into structured, searchable data instantly.

Manually entering a single receipt can take 2-5 minutes, including finding it, typing details, and filing. For 20 receipts a week, that's over 1.5 hours lost.

Automation processes receipts in seconds as they're uploaded, extracting data instantly and logging it directly to your database or spreadsheet. Over a month, this can save a small team 6-10 hours, freeing them for higher-value tasks like analysis or client work.

Yes, modern AI extraction tools like VLM Run are trained on diverse datasets and can handle various formats (JPEG, PNG, PDF) and multiple languages. They recognize common receipt layouts from different countries and merchants.

The key is the AI's ability to identify data fields contextually, not by fixed positions. For best results, ensure receipts are clear and legible, but the system is designed to handle real-world variations.

Connecting Google Drive to Airtable creates a seamless digital paper trail. Receipts stored in Drive are automatically processed, and the extracted data populates an Airtable base with structured fields.

This gives you a centralized expense log that's searchable, filterable by date, merchant, or employee, and ready for reporting. It also creates automatic backups and audit trails, improving compliance and financial oversight.

AI extraction accuracy typically exceeds 95% for clear, standard receipts. The system uses contextual understanding, not just OCR, to identify fields correctly.

If a mistake occurs, most workflows include a validation step where a human can review and correct flagged entries before they sync to your master database. This hybrid approach ensures data quality while still automating the bulk of the work.

Once data is extracted, you can build automated approval workflows, categorize expenses by department or project, enforce spending policies by flagging out-of-policy purchases, generate monthly reports, sync with accounting software like QuickBooks, and even predict cash flow.

You can also set up alerts for duplicate submissions or unusually high expenses, turning basic tracking into intelligent financial management.

Pre-built apps offer limited customization and often work with specific accounting platforms. A custom automation built with tools like n8n lets you tailor the entire flow to your exact business rules, data fields, and approval processes.

You control where data goes, how it's validated, and what triggers happen next. This is crucial for businesses with unique expense policies, multiple cost centers, or specific integration needs that off-the-shelf tools can't accommodate.

Yes, GrowwStacks specializes in building tailored automation solutions for businesses. While this free template provides a foundation, we can design a complete system that matches your exact expense policies, approval hierarchies, and software stack.

We handle everything from AI model training for your specific receipt types to integration with your existing accounting software and custom reporting dashboards. Book a free consultation to discuss your requirements.

Need a Custom Receipt Automation?

This free template is a starting point. Our team builds fully tailored automation systems for your specific business needs.